The T-WNB-3Y-208-P can measure two or three separate branch circuits simultaneously. Note that an S-UCC-M00x 

pulse input adapter (for H21, H22, U30, or RX3000 series) or a CABLE-2.5-STEREO (for pulse input-compatible ZW 
series) is required for each circuit monitored.

Electrical Service Types 

Below is a list of service types, with connections and recommended WattNode models. Note: the WattNode ground 
connection improves measurement accuracy, but is not required for safety. 

Model Type 

Phase to 

Neutral 

Phase to 

Phase 

Electrical 

Service Types* 

WNB-3Y-208-P Wye 120 

VAC 

208–240 

VAC 

1 Phase 2 Wire 120V with neutral 
1 Phase 3 Wire 120V/240V with neutral 
3 Phase 4 Wire Wye 120V/208V with neutral 

WNB-3D-240-P 

Delta 

or Wye 

120–140 

VAC 

208–240 

VAC 

1 Phase 2 Wire 208V (No neutral) 
1 Phase 2 Wire 240V (No neutral) 
1 Phase 3 Wire 120V/240V with neutral 
3 Phase 3 Wire Delta 208V (No neutral) 
3 Phase 4 Wire Wye 120V/208V with neutral 
3 Phase 4 Wire Delta 120/208/240V with neutral 

WNB-3D-480-P 

Delta 

or Wye 

277 VAC 

480 VAC 

3 Phase 3 Wire Delta 480V (No neutral) 
3 Phase 4 Wire Wye 277V/480V with neutral 
3 Phase 4 Wire Delta 240/415/480V with neutral 

*The wire count does NOT include ground. It only includes neutral (if present) and phase wires.
